CBEC to Chief Commissioner- Asign cases for adjudication on monthly basis

October 23, 2015 1868 Views 0 comment Print

Chief Commissioners should assign the cases of adjudication on a monthly basis in his jurisdiction to the officers in personam and ensure that the officer to whom the case has been assigned disposes of the said case. In the event of his transfer out of that jurisdiction he should not be relieved till he has disposed of the said cases.

Reg. Mandatory Filing of customs documents under digital signature from 01.01.2016

October 23, 2015 922 Views 0 comment Print

Circular No. 26/2015- Customs CBEC has decided that all importers, exporters using services of Customs Brokers for formalities under Customs Act, 1962, shipping lines and air lines shall file customs documents under digital signature certificates mandatorily with effect from 01.01.2016. The importers/ exporters desirous of filing Bill of Entry or Shipping Bill individually may however have the option of filing declarations/ documents without using digital signature. Further, wherever the customs process documents are digitally signed, the Customs will not insist on the user to physically sign the said documents.
